Cyril is in India and he has a dual mission: to catch a barramundi in the wild mangoes of the Arabian Sea and a mahseer, the legendary fish of India. And in this adventure, he encounters all kinds of wild animals.

Cyril is in Argentina, in the province of Neuquén, in the mountains of Patagonia! He's here to discover incredible landscapes, extraordinary people, and truly… impressive trout!

Argentine
Cyril is in Argentina in the province of Corrientes in pursuit of a giant dorado. He begins his adventure in swamps infested with piranhas and caimans before finding himself in improbable fishing spots.

Ontario, Grands Lacs
Cyril is in southern Ontario, Canada, to fish on the Niagara River and the Great Lakes; his ultimate goal is to catch a muskellunge, the second largest freshwater predatory fish in Canada.

Saturday Night Live
Saturday Night Live is an Emmy Award-winning late-night comedy showcase.
Since its inception in 1975, "SNL" has launched the careers of many of the brightest comedy performers of their generation. As The New York Times noted on the occasion of the show's Emmy-winning 25th Anniversary special in 1999, "in defiance of both time and show business convention, 'SNL' is still the most pervasive influence on the art of comedy in contemporary culture." At the close of the century, "Saturday Night Live" placed seventh on Entertainment Weekly's list of the Top 100 Entertainers of the past fifty years.
